A chord, 20cm long, is 12cm from the centre of the circle. Calculate, correct to one decimal place, the: (a) angle subtended by the chord at the centre of the circle; (b) perimeter of the minor segment cut off by the chord. [Take
[tex]\pi[/tex]
3.142]​

Answers

Step-by-step explanation:

there are 2 formulas to calculate the length of a chord, depending on what pieces of information we have.

here now we have the length of the chord, which we need to find the radius, which we need to find the angle at the center.

chord length = 2×sqrt(r² - d²)

chord length = 2×r×sin(c/2)

r is the radius, d is the distance of the chord from the center of the circle, c is the angle of the chord at the center of the circle.

20 =2×sqrt(r² - 12²) = 2×sqrt(r² - 144)

10 = sqrt(r² - 144)

100 = r² - 144

244 = r²

r = 15.62049935... cm

20 = 2×r×sin(c/2) = 2×15.62049935...×sin(c/2)

10 = 15.62049935...×sin(c/2)

sin(c/2) = 10/15.62049935... = 0.6401844...

c/2 = 39.80557109...°

c = 79.61114218...° ≈ 79.6°

(a) the angle subtended by the chord at the center of the circle is about 79.6°.

(b)

the arc length of a segment is 2pi×r × c/360

in our case

2×3.142×15.62049935...×79.61114218.../360 =

= 21.70713182... cm

the whole perimeter of the segment is then arc length + chord length =

= 21.70713182... + 20 = 41.70713182... ≈ 41.7 cm

the perimeter of the minor segment cut off by the chord is about 41.7 cm.

a player wins a minimum award of $10000 by correctly matching four numbers, of the five, drawn from the white balls (1 through 56) and matching the number on the gold ball (1 through 46). what is the probability of winning this minimum prize?

Answers

The probability of winning the minimum prize is approximately 0.00014

To calculate the probability of winning this minimum prize, we need to first find out the total number of possible combinations of numbers that can be drawn.

There are 56 white balls, and 5 balls are drawn from them, so the total number of possible combinations of white balls is

56 choose 5 = 56! / (5! (56-5)!) = 3,819,816

There are 46 gold balls, and only 1 is drawn from them. Therefore, the total number of possible combinations of gold balls is simply 46.

To win the minimum prize, we need to correctly match 4 out of the 5 white balls drawn, and we also need to match the gold ball.

The number of ways to choose 4 white balls out of 5 is

5 choose 4 = 5! / (4! (5-4)!) = 5

So, the total number of ways to win the minimum prize is the product of the number of ways to choose 4 white balls and the number of ways to choose 1 gold ball

Total number of ways to win the minimum prize = 5 × 46 = 230

Therefore, the probability of winning the minimum prize is

Probability = number of ways to win the minimum prize / total number of possible combinations

Probability = 230 / (3,819,816 × 46) = 0.00014

Today you bought a brand new 2022 Ford Mustang for $34,145. Unfortunately, cars depreciate in value quickly and the Ford Mustang depreciates at a rate of 8%.
a. Find the cars value after it has depreciated for 9 years.
b. A car is considered to be a classic car after it is 25 years old. Determine the cars value after it has depreciated for 25 years.
c. A classic cars value will raise as there are fewer and fewer of them left around. If the Mustang will start to grow at a rate of 14% each year, determine its value in the year 2059. (remember for the first 25 years, the value is going down, then after 25 years, its value starts to go back up again)

Answers

Answer:

a)  $16,122

b) $4,246

c) $112,357

Step-by-step explanation:

What is depreciation

We should calculate the depreciation using the declining balance method
This uses the technique of computing the depreciation on the previous year's depreciated value

As an example
If the original cost is $100 and depreciation rate is 10%( 0.10 in decimal)

Depreciation Year 1 = 100 x 0.10 = $10

Depreciated value at end of year 1 = 100 - 10 = $90

For the second year, the depreciation amount is computed on $90
= 90 x 0.10 = $ 9

Depreciated amount at end of year 2 = 90 - 9 = $81

The depreciated value of an asset valued at $A at time of purchase at a depreciation rate of r (in decimal) for n years is given by the formula
A' = A(1 - r)ⁿ

We are given
A = $34,145
r = 8/100 = 0.08 therefore 1 - r = 1 - 0.08 = 0.92

a) Depreciated value after 9 years:
A' = 34145(0.92)⁹
    = 16121.95

Rounded to the nearest dollar that would be $16,122 ANSWER

b) Depreciated Value after 25 years

A' = 34145(0.92)²⁵

    = $4,246  rounded to the nearest dollar

c) Car's value after 50 years

At the end of 25 years, the Mustang has become a classic with a value of $4, 246

Then it starts to appreciate at the rate of 14% (0.14 in decimal)

The appreciated value each year after 25 years is given by
A'' = A'( 1 + r)ⁿ

where r is the rate of appreciation and n is the number of years

We are given r = 14% = 0.14

1 + r = 1.14

n = 25

A' = 4,246 the value after 25 years from purchase

Car value after 50 years = car value after 25 years appreciated for the next 25 years

= 4246(1.14)²⁵

= $112,357 rounded to the nearest $

So you can really make a killing after 25 years. As an interesting side note, the value of the car will reach the original value 16 years after 25 years or a total of 41 years after purchase
